Concealed

In contrast to conventional hinges, which protrude out of the window frame and interfere with the sash's line, hidden hinges are integrated into the frame. They are constructed into frames, which makes them the ideal option for modern and minimalist styles. They also help to ensure that the rebate seal is unbroken, which increases the strength and thermal insulation of the window. Hidden hinges are less likely to be damaged or destroyed by debris or weather.

These hinges have been tested to the extent of 20,000 cycles and are made of high-quality ferritic iron. These hinges are simple to install and allow you to finish the job quickly. Installing them is straightforward and you don't require any special tools. You can pick between hinges that open from the sides or top opening hinges, depending on your needs.

These hinges can be used to replace existing uPVC window frames or to make brand new ones. Unlike traditional uPVC hinges, which are only available in certain sizes they are available in a variety of sizes and stack heights. They are also made to be BS EN1670 grade 4, which means they are resistant against dirt and weather. Additionally, they can handle an amount that is up to 25kg.

A concealed hinge is easier to maintain because the components are concealed. The covers of exposed hinges tend to change color and becoming brittle with time. In addition the gaps between the covers and the veneer could trap dust, which makes it difficult to keep them clean.

Another benefit of concealed hinges is that they're not as loud as hinges that are exposed. Because they are in the sash's rebate, they do not vibrate or rattle. They can be used with a variety of window materials, such as aluminium and wood. They also work with larger windows, such as casement windows.

Security

When it concerns the security of your home the strength and quality of the window's hinge is an important element. A hinge made of uPVC which is reinforced and strengthened can be more effective than standard ones in preventing burglars from trying to lever open your windows.  This Resource site  rate many uPVC hinges for windows and doors for security. The best hinges will be tested in accordance with BS EN 1935, which defines the requirements for hinges designed to allow windows or doors to move in a single direction (closed/opened) and not rotate more than 30 millimeters away from their initial position.

The strength of a uPVC hinge is also crucial, and many are made of materials like aluminium or steel to provide extraordinary levels of durability and resistance against attempts at forced entry. Advanced uPVC hinges are treated with corrosion-resistant coatings and materials to enhance their ability resist damage from external weather conditions.

A good way to ensure that your double glazed replacement windows are safe and secure is to have them fitted with a multi-point locking system. This will stop your windows from being harmed in any way and help to keep intruders out of your home.

There are a myriad of uPVC hinges designed for security and can be incorporated in a multi-point locking system. However there are other options available. They could include anti-bump or anti-drill options, both of which protect windows from attempts to get into homes.

Installing security brackets on your uPVC hinges is a great method to increase the security. They are sturdy, interlocking brackets that strengthen the hinges of the window frame and make it more difficult for burglars to break into your windows.
